Silver Hook
Deltote uncula (Clerck, 1759)
Noctuidae: Eustrotiinae
2412 / 73.026

Similar Species: None
Forewing: 11-12mm.
Flight: One generation May-July.
Foodplant:   Grasses, sedges and rushes.
Red List: Least Concern (LC)
GB Status: Common
Former Status: Local
Verification Grade:  Adult: 2
Status
Scarce.
Unmistakable moth.
Flies by day when disturbed, and from dusk.
Fens, marshes, acid bogs and boggy heathland.

Recorded in 30 (41%) of 74 10k Squares.
First Recorded in 1871.
Last Recorded in 2023.
